Sanju Samson Delivers When It Matters Most ๐๐ฎ๐ณ
There is something powerful about seeing a player grab his chance at the perfect moment. Sanju Samson did exactly that. After limited opportunities earlier in the tournament, he walked in with calm focus and played an innings that felt mature and fearless at the same time. His 97 not out from just 50 balls came with confident strokes and smart decision making.

Gambhirโs Honest Assessment Before England ๐ฌโก
The celebration did not last long because the next challenge is already here. England, led by Harry Brook, have looked sharp in the Super Eights. They won all their matches in that phase and seem to be gaining confidence at the right time.
Gambhir did not downplay the task ahead. Speaking after the match, he acknowledged England as a quality side filled with match winners. Wankhede Brings A Fresh Test ๐๏ธ๐ฅ
Now the stage shifts to Wankhede Stadium in Mumbai. Anyone who follows cricket regularly on ์จ์ ํฐ๋น knows this ground can produce exciting contests. The pitch often supports big scores, and the atmosphere adds extra intensity.
Conditions in Mumbai will not mirror Kolkata. The bounce, the pace and even the crowd energy can change the rhythm of a game. Gambhir highlighted that playing at Wankhede is tough, but he framed it as an opportunity for the team to step up again.
For India, it cannot depend on one hero. Samsonโs brilliance was unforgettable, yet semi finals demand contributions from everyone. The top order must build solid starts, the middle order must finish strongly, and bowlers need to hold their nerve during key overs.
